Tremont: frequently asked questions
Is Tremont's water safe to drink?
Tremont is an active community water system regulated under the Safe Drinking Water Act, overseen by the IL state drinking water program. EPA SDWA violation and enforcement records for this system are being added to AquaCensus from EPA ECHO; consult EPA ECHO or your annual Consumer Confidence Report for its current compliance status.
Who runs Tremont?
Tremont (PWSID IL1790700) is a local government-owned community water system, regulated by the IL state drinking water program.
How many people does Tremont serve?
Tremont reports serving 2,114 people through 1,104 service connections in Tazewell County, Illinois.
Where does Tremont get its water?
EPA SDWIS lists this system's primary water source as groundwater.
